The wholesale industry is undergoing significant transformations driven by innovations in supply chain management. This article explores how wholesale suppliers can enhance their efficiency and profitability through these advancements.
Technology Integration
Integrating technology into supply chain processes is crucial for modern wholesalers. Technologies such as cloud computing, AI, and machine learning can optimize inventory management, forecasting, and logistics, leading to increased operational efficiency.
Data Analytics for Informed Decision-Making
Utilizing data analytics allows wholesalers to make informed decisions about inventory levels, pricing strategies, and market trends. By analyzing data, suppliers can adjust their operations to better meet demand and improve profitability.
Collaboration and Communication
Enhancing collaboration and communication within the supply chain is vital. Utilizing collaborative tools can improve information sharing between suppliers, manufacturers, and logistics providers, leading to streamlined processes and improved efficiency.
Adopting Just-in-Time Inventory
The Just-in-Time (JIT) inventory system minimizes waste and reduces holding costs. By implementing JIT practices, wholesalers can ensure they have the right products available without overstocking, enhancing overall profitability.
Conclusion
Wholesale supply chain innovations are crucial for enhancing efficiency and profitability. By integrating technology, utilizing data analytics, improving collaboration, and adopting JIT practices, suppliers can better navigate the complexities of the wholesale industry.
